Hollywood Beach is a beach in the United States. The water temperature around Hollywood Beach changes slightly year round. The temperature ranges from 24.5°C (76.2°F) in February up to 29.7°C (85.5°F) in the month of July, as shown in the graph below. The average water temperature throughout the year is 27°C (80°F) and the best time for water activities is summer, since Hollywood Beach is located in the northern hemisphere.

What wetsuit is recommended for Hollywood Beach?

The water temperature at Hollywood Beach is extremely warm, reaching up to 30°C (85°F) in the months of June, July, and August. During this time, in the summer, a wetsuit is typically not required for surfing, swimming, snorkelling, or diving . However, during January, February, and March, sea temperatures reach lows of nearly 25°C (76°F). During these months, a 1mm top or a jumpsuit might be required to feel comfortable, but some people might even be ok without a rashguard or light top . For very windy conditions and cold mornings/evenings, it might be recommended to carry a thin wetsuit or jumpsuit.
